Output efbea4ab6cd8820ea82a13df29dba6f62d25d5d969232f6f8c493cdf7dd995f2:6

value
694667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7b2e859e3040c973c3e3b47c19a0f264267747b OP_EQUALVERIFY OP_CHECKSIG
address
1KCuntqVT6FrzTAdHwobTnPpqqVPPsb4Pc
transaction
efbea4ab6cd8820ea82a13df29dba6f62d25d5d969232f6f8c493cdf7dd995f2
spent
true